Has anyone ever used a walk behind 24" vibratory padfoot roller?

My site is fairly small so I'm not worried about the extra time it would take, however they seem pretty light weight. Do they do the same job as a larger pad foot roller?

Thanks for the help, trying to get all this planning and research taken care of before putting the plan in action.
